Description of issue
Turkish AI Doesn't Know How to Go Down the Ottoman Path

Game Version
1.11.4 BETA

Enabled DLC


Do you have mods enabled?
(DID NOT ANSWER QUESTION)

Description
Before you play the game, in the settings, you can preset the alt-history path the AI will take. For Turkey, there is an Ottoman path, but for some reason, it gets a democratic path led by Celal Bayar most of the time. Maybe the AI is confused with the event chain or Ataturk's premature death or retirement might be screwing with the issues.

Steps to Reproduce
1. Set Turkey to become Ottoman before starting the game
2. Watch (may need to repeat)
